What others, in her position, would rather relish and rollick in, is what our sister found great displeasure in. The harder she sought anonymity, the greater she gained celebrity status and fame. Hear out her 'heart-kicks': "one of my regrets would be that I will never again have the pleasure of sneeking into a cafe, any cafe I like, sitting down and diving into my world, and no one knowing what I am doing, and no one bothering about me, and being totally anonymous, that fantastic"
You don't sell 270 million copies of 5 books, interpreted into 62 languages, including Chinese, and not expect your craving for anonymity to be torn to shreds!
Talking of records; never in publishing history has the first print run of a book amassed up to 10.8 million copies. Never also, in publishing history has 9 million copies of a book (I mean, her latest and 6th serial) been sold on the first day of its release!
The movies from her first three books havs grossed in over $2.6 Billion Dollars. In fact this terrific author, having no other records to break, behaved true to type - begun like the skillful 'Potter' that she is, to smash her own 'pots' to pieces, for better vessel than she had ever created.
'Pottermania' has entered into the lexicon of the of the entertainment industry. The multi-million Dollar licensing deals for Harry Potter products testified to this. Films, stamps, cauldren, glasses, wands, caps, cotumes, musical albums... all give trademark endorsements of the terrific imagery conjured from the mind of this humble genius called J.K. Rowling.
